Product Overview

AIMS Innovation
AIMS Innovation

Description: AIMS Innovation is a comprehensive software platform for managing innovation programs and portfolios within an organization. It allows companies to manage idea campaigns, collaborate on new ideas and innovations, select the best ideas to pursue, and track them through development and commercialization.

Type: software

AppBeat
AppBeat

Description: AppBeat is an application performance monitoring and management tool that helps developers optimize mobile and web apps. It monitors app performance, user experience, crashes, network requests, and more in real-time.

Type: software
